QUEST RARE MINERALS TO TRADE ON NYSE AMEX

Quest Rare Minerals Ltd. has been approved for listing on the New York Stock Exchange Amex. Quest's common shares will commence trading on NYSE Amex on Monday, May 23, 2011, under the symbol QRM.

"We are pleased to welcome Quest Rare Minerals to the NYSE Euronext family of listed companies," said Scott Cutler, executive vice-president and co-head of U.S. listings and cash execution, NYSE Euronext. "Quest Rare Minerals and its shareholders will benefit from the superior market quality, services and technology provided by NYSE Amex. We look forward to a great partnership."

"We are very pleased that our shares will start trading on NYSE Amex," said Peter J. Cashin, Quest's president and chief executive officer. "This will facilitate trading in our shares by investors in the United States. In addition, our listing on NYSE Amex will increase Quest's exposure to the U.S. investment community."

Quest's registration statement on Form 40-F, filed with the United States Securities and Exchange Commission pursuant to Section 12 of the United States Securities Exchange Act of 1934, has been declared effective by the SEC. Quest filed the registration statement on Form 40-F in connection with its application to list on NYSE Amex. A copy of Quest's Form 40-F is available on EDGAR.

The listing on NYSE Amex will not affect Quest's listing on the TSX Venture Exchange, where Quest will continue to trade under the symbol QRM.
